Output 3752653d66d5d7c6536ac7983a3c2b571255eb79930665342a9a52508b3502ff:0

value
507936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f0506a1c2eefae96a53ed9dacdda63ab46642f OP_EQUAL
address
3D5dbeZd8MH5XHUqYU4RRn5vRcTRSGJu3L
transaction
3752653d66d5d7c6536ac7983a3c2b571255eb79930665342a9a52508b3502ff
confirmations
278288
spent
true